Foam concrete leveling is a practical solution used to address uneven or sinking concrete surfaces. The process involves injecting a specialized foam into the existing concrete slab, which then expands and lifts the surface back to its proper position. This method is often chosen because it is minimally invasive, quick to perform, and effective at restoring the stability and appearance of dri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ors. By using foam concrete leveling, property owners can improve the safety and functionality of their outdoor spaces without the need for extensive demolition or replacement.
This service helps solve common problems associated with settled or cracked concrete. Over time, soil shifts, erosion, or poor initial installation can cause slabs to sink or become uneven. This can lead to tripping hazards, drainage issues, and further structural damage if left unaddressed. Foam concrete leveling can fill voids beneath the slab, stabilize the ground, and prevent further settling. It is an efficient way to correct existing problems and extend the lifespan of concrete surfaces, making outdoor areas safer and more visually appealing.

The overview below groups typical Foam Concrete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lawrence, KS.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or foam concrete leveling projects range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s in Lawrence, KS, fall within this range, covering small patches or localized areas. Larger or more complex repairs may require higher budgets but are less common in this category.
Mid-Size Projects - for moderate leveling work on larger sections of a driveway or patio, local contractors generally charge between $600-$1,500. This is the most common range for standard residential jobs, offering a balance between scope and cost.
Large or Complex Jobs - extensive leveling on multiple slabs or uneven surfaces can range from $1,500-$3,000. These projects are less frequent but necessary for significant structural issues or extensive surface areas.
Full Replacement or Major Repairs - in cases where foam concrete leveling is part of a larger renovation or replacement, costs can exceed $3,000 and may reach $5,000 or more. Such projects are less typical and involve substantial work beyond simple leveling.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is foam concrete leveling? Foam concrete leveling involves injecting a specialized foam mixture beneath a surface to fill voids and raise uneven areas, resulting in a smoother, more stable surface.
Can foam concrete leveling be used on different types of surfaces? Yes, foam concrete leveling can be applied to various surfaces such as driveways, sidewalks, and floors to address unevenness and sinking issues.
How do local contractors perform foam concrete leveling? Local service providers typically prepare the area, drill small access holes, and inject the foam mixture to lift and level the surface effectively.
Is foam concrete leveling suitable for repair projects? Foam concrete leveling is often used for repair and maintenance to restore the original levelness of existing surfaces without extensive demolition.
What are the benefits of choosing foam concrete leveling services? Foam concrete leveling offers a quick, minimally invasive solution that can improve surface stability and reduce the risk of further damage.
